About Liquid Methyl Methacrylate
Our company is an eminent trader, supplier, exporter, importer, distributor and retailer of Methyl Methacrylate. It is a colorless liquid with the formula CH2=C(CH3)COOCH3. This methyl ester of methacrylic acid (MAA), it is a monomer produced on a large scale for the production of poly(methy; methacrylate) (PMMA). Methyl Methacrylate is prepared several methods, the principal one being the acetone cyanohydrin (ACH) route. ACH is produced by condensation of acetone and hydrogen cyanide. Key Applications and Industrial UsageMethyl Methacrylate is an essential raw material in the manufacture of acrylic plastics and resins, serving industries such as automotive, construction, and signage. Its capacity to impart strength, clarity, and chemical resistance makes it a preferred ingredient for creating versatile adhesives and coatings. The products excellent performance profile contributes to its broad adoption across multiple industrial sectors.
Safe Handling and Storage GuidelinesDue to its flammability and volatility, MMA requires careful handling. Store it in tightly sealed containers within cool, dry, well-ventilated spaces, away from any ignition sources. Adhering to recommended safety practices, such as using chemical-resistant gloves and ensuring spill containment, mitigates risk. Observing these guidelines secures both product integrity and workplace safety.
FAQs of Liquid Methyl Methacrylate:
Q: How should Liquid Methyl Methacrylate be stored to maintain its quality?
A: Store MMA in tightly closed drums or IBC tanks in cool, dry, and well-ventilated areas, away from heat, sparks, or open flames. Proper storage ensures the product remains stable and effective for up to 12 months from the manufacture date.
Q: What are the main industrial applications of Methyl Methacrylate?
A: Methyl Methacrylate is primarily used in the production of acrylic plastics, resins, and adhesives. It is widely employed in automotive parts, construction materials, signage, and coatings due to its clarity, strength, and chemical resistance.
Q: When is it necessary to observe extra precautions while handling MMA?
A: Extra caution is needed when transferring, mixing, or working with MMA near ignition sources due to its low flash point (10C) and high vapor pressure. Always use appropriate personal protective equipment (PPE) and handle it in a well-ventilated area.
Q: Where is MMA typically used within an industrial setting?
A: MMA is commonly utilized in manufacturing plants involved in processing plastics, adhesives, and coatings. It is also used in facilities producing cast acrylic sheets and molded products that require high optical clarity and durability.
Q: What is the benefit of using Methyl Methacrylate in production processes?
A: MMA enhances product performance by offering excellent clarity, weatherability, and mechanical strength. Its use in resins and adhesives contributes to the durability and longevity of end products, making it valuable for demanding industrial applications.
Q: How does MMA interact with water and other solvents?
A: Methyl Methacrylate is insoluble in water but dissolves readily in most organic solvents, allowing for flexible formulation in industrial manufacturing processes.
